What is a Retirement Calculator?
A retirement calculator is a Achieve Financial Independence tool that assists people estimate the amount of cash they will require to retire easily. By entering particular parameters such as existing savings, expected contributions, and prepared for living expenditures, users can predict how much they might have at retirement. With these forecasts, people can make informed decisions about their retirement savings strategy.
Why Use a Retirement Calculator?
The benefits of utilizing a retirement calculator incorporate a number of key aspects:

Future Planning: It supplies users with insight into whether their existing savings rate will be sufficient.

Recognizing Shortfalls: It helps recognize spaces in retirement savings early on.

Setting goal: Users can set clearer financial goals based on sensible forecasts.

Budgeting: Understanding future capital needs help in budgeting for present expenses.

There are various types of retirement calculators readily available online, each accommodating various financial situations and preferences. Here’s a short summary of some popular types:

Basic Retirement Calculators: These supply a fast quote based on general inputs such as cost savings and anticipated retirement age.

Advanced Retirement Calculators: These require more comprehensive inputs, including intricate variables like taxes, health care expenses, and numerous income streams.

Individual retirement account Calculators: Tools particularly developed to evaluate Individual Retirement Accounts, assisting users comprehend prospective development.

Social Security Calculators: These give insights into the optimum time to draw on Social Security benefits for maximum payouts.
